How they compare
Jordan currently reports 1,606 TJ against 973.5 TJ in Germany, a difference of 632.5 TJ.
That makes Jordan's figure about 1.6 times Germany's.
The two have swapped places 3 times across 22 shared years of data; in 2003 it was Germany ahead.
Germany ranks 74th and Jordan ranks 71st of 162 countries.
Across the 3 decades both report, Germany averaged higher in 1 and Jordan in 2.

About this data
The FAOSTAT domain Bioenergy contains data on bioenergy use and bioenergy production, covering the following items: i) animal waste, ii) bagasse, iii) bio jet kerosene, iv) biodiesel, v) biogases, vi) biogasoline, vii) black liquor, viii) charcoal, ix) fuelwood, x) other liquid biofuels, xi) other vegetal material and residues.
